January 12

Prayer for Sunday Worship

O God, you make me glad with the weekly remembrance of the glorious resurrection of your Son my Lord: Give me the peace to worship you with my whole heart and mind, forgetting the cares of the world, and dwelling with you for a short moment with my entire being. And give me this day such blessing through my worship of you, that the week to come may be spent in living knowledge of your peace; through Jesus Christ our Lord. Amen.

Prayer to Inspire Others

Lord, I ask you to inspire me to encourage others by what I say and do today and throughout the coming week. God and Father of all people, never let me look down on others or make anyone feel inferior.

Lord, show me how to live this week with genuine concern for others. In expressing my care, may I show people that they are valued, loved and appreciated for who they are. Amen.

Father, teach me to walk by faith and not by sight. Thank you for giving me the faith to believe that you exist and that you are a rewarder of those who seek you. Father, you said, “Seek my face.” My heart says, “Your face, LORD, do I seek.” Teach me your way, O LORD, and lead me on a level path because of my enemies who speak contrary to your word, which is Truth. Walking in the light I have true fellowship with you and with others. The blood of Jesus Christ cleanses me from all sin. I pray in the powerful name of Jesus. Amen
